
What is Benign Prostatic Hyperplasia?
Benign Prostatic Hyperplasia (BPH) or prostate enlargement is the most common non-cancerous enlargement of the prostate gland in men.
BPH rarely causes symptoms before age 40, but more than half of all men in their 60s and as many as 8 out of 10 men in their 80s have some symptoms of BPH.
The actual factors of BPH are unknown. However, it has been known that BPH occurs mainly in older men, probably related to aging and hormone. As a person ages, more testosterone will be converted to dihydrotestosterone (DHT), which will lead to high occurrence of BPH.
